Finding Disaster Shelters across Your Area

When disaster strikes, having a safe place to go is crucial. Being aware of the location of accessible disaster shelters can provide a difference between safety and risk. Thankfully, there are methods available to help you discover these vital havens in your community.

Start by checking the website of your local emergency management agency or city government. They often publish comprehensive information about shelter locations, hours of operation, and particular services offered.

Additionally, you can contact your local community center as they often serve as primary shelters during emergencies. Remember that shelter locations may change, so it's always best to check the information closer to the time of a potential emergency.

By planning ahead, you can increase your chances of finding safety and help during a disaster.

Survival Shelter Locations: Prepare for Any Crisis

When disaster arrives, having a pre-determined shelter location can mean the difference between safety and trouble. Your best shelter won't just be any accessible structure - it needs to cater your specific needs and the possible dangers you face. Consider factors like weather conditions, natural hazards, and range to essential resources like food.

  • A subterranean location can provide safety from severe weather events.
  • Isolated shelters may offer peace of mind, but ensure accessibility and communication.
  • Consider a planned meeting point for your family in case you get divided.

Remember that the ideal shelter location may not always be the most accessible. Prioritize safety and reliability when making your choice.
